#473358 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#473358 is composed of 27.8% red, 20%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 19.3% cyan, 42%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 272.4 degrees, a saturation of 26.6% and a lightness of 27.3%. #473358 color hex could be obtained by blending #8e66b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

● #473358 color description : Very dark desaturated violet.
#473358 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#473358 has RGB values of R:71, G:51,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.19, M:0.42, Y:0,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 4666200.
